MATLAB基础与常用函数详解

需积分: 50 1 下载量 74 浏览量 更新于2024-09-14 收藏 278KB PDF 举报
"MATLAB 常用函数简介" MATLAB是一种强大的数学计算和数据分析环境,其内置了丰富的函数和命令,使得用户能够高效地进行数值计算、符号计算、图形绘制以及文件操作等任务。以下是对MATLAB常用函数的详细介绍: 一、通用命令 在MATLAB中,帮助命令如`help`, `helpbrowser`, `doc`和`helpdesk`提供了详尽的在线文档和教程,帮助用户了解各种函数和概念。工作空间管理包括`clear`用于清除变量,`quit`和`exit`退出MATLAB,`save`保存变量到文件,`who`和`whos`列出工作空间的变量,`format`调整显示格式,`what`显示当前目录的MATLAB文件,`more`实现分页输出,而`which`查找函数所在的路径。 二、基本运算 MATLAB支持算术运算(加、减、乘、除等),关系运算(比较大小),逻辑操作(AND, OR, NOT等)以及特殊运算符,如指数和对数运算。 三、编程语言结构 MATLAB的编程语言结构包括控制语句(如`for`, `while`, `if`, `switch`等)、计算运行、脚本文件和函数定义、参数处理、信息显示和交互式输入。 四、基本矩阵函数和操作 MATLAB以其矩阵运算为核心,提供了创建基本矩阵、获取矩阵信息、执行矩阵操作(如加减乘除、转置、逆矩阵等)的功能。此外,还有特殊变量和常量(如π, i/j),特殊矩阵(如单位矩阵、零矩阵),字符串与数字之间的转换,以及字符串操作和单元数组处理。 五、基本数学函数 涵盖三角函数、指数和对数函数、复数运算,以及取整和求余等数学操作。 六、矩阵函数和数值线性代数 涉及矩阵分析、线性方程组的求解、特征值和奇异值计算,以及矩阵函数的应用。 七、数据分析 包括基本的数据运算和数值积分,便于对数据进行处理和分析。 八、多项式、非线性方程和常微分方程 MATLAB支持多项式函数的运算,非线性方程的求解,以及常微分方程的数值解。 九、作图函数 MATLAB提供了一系列的绘图命令,可以创建基础图形,定制坐标轴,添加图形标注,使得数据可视化更加直观。 十、文件操作 MATLAB支持文件的读写,允许用户将数据存储到文件或从文件中加载。 十一、示例函数 包含多种示例,帮助用户学习和理解MATLAB的功能。 十二、符号工具包 该工具包提供了符号计算功能,包括基本操作、线性代数、化简、微积分、方程求解、变量精度控制、积分变换,甚至与其他软件如Maple的接口。 十三、其他函数 涵盖坐标变换等多种功能,拓展了MATLAB的应用范围。 这些函数和命令是MATLAB使用者的基础工具,熟练掌握它们能够有效地提升在MATLAB环境中的工作效率和问题解决能力。